Hotel Management of New Orleans is seeking an organized, detail-oriented, and energetic Recruiter to join our Human Resources team!
Essential Duties and Responsibilities
RecruitmentPrimarily responsible for recruitment and onboarding of new employees based on company demand.
Manage and maximize use of all recruiting channels (Paycom, Zip Recruiter, walk-in applicants, job fairs, websites).
Anticipate hiring needs and develop job descriptions and specifications.
Attract suitable candidates through databases, online employment forums, social media, etc.
Assess applications and conduct interviews to fill open positions.
Assess applicants’ knowledge, skills, and experience to best match open positions.
Complete paperwork for new hires.
Promote the company’s reputation and attractiveness as a good employment opportunity.
Maintain open communication with managers to identify vacancies, schedule interviews, and track new employee follow-ups/onboarding reviews.
Provide recruitment reports to team managers.
Manage all onboarding paperwork and processes; complete new hire checklists.
Provide training schedules, follow up with uniform, nametags, bus pass programs, drug tests, background checks.
Add employees to payroll systems.
Report new hires to the Louisiana New Hire Directory.
Stay up-to-date on employment legislation and regulations, and enforce them within the company.
Administer E-Verify pre-employment screening and verify employment eligibility by maintaining current I-9 documents.
Manage offboarding paperwork and processes (Pink 77, termination of benefits).
Develop and execute company policies and procedures with the Director of Human Resources.
Collaborate with department managers to maintain consistent job requirements.
Assist the Human Resources Director with strategic management and employee relations programs for retention.
Prepare reports as needed by the Director of Human Resources.
Conduct employment verifications and referrals.
Keep personnel files up-to-date for all three companies, including licenses and permits.
Support the Human Resources Director in reporting and computer functions.
